Ingredients
  

3 ripe bananas, sliced

1 cup creamy peanut butter

1 cup Greek yogurt

1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

2 cups granola (your choice of flavor)

1/4 cup chocolate chips (optional)

M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ions
 

In a mixing bowl, combine the Greek yogurt, peanut butter, honey (or maple syrup), and vanilla extract. Whisk together until smooth and creamy.

    In a trifle bowl or individual serving glasses, start layering your ingredients. Begin with a layer of the peanut butter yogurt mixture, spreading evenly at the bottom.

      Next, add a layer of sliced bananas followed by a layer of granola. If you are using chocolate chips, sprinkle some on top of the granola layer.

        Repeat the layers: peanut butter yogurt mixture, bananas, granola, and chocolate chips until you reach the top of your serving dish. You can aim for about 3-4 layers depending on the height of your bowl.

          Finish with a final dollop of the peanut butter yogurt mixture on top, a few banana slices, and an optional sprinkle of chocolate chips or granola for garnish.

            Chill in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es to an hour before serving to allow the flavors to meld together.

              Prep Time: 15 minutes | Total Time: 1 hour (including chilling) | Servings: 4-6

                - Presentation Tips: Serve with fresh mint leaves on top for a pop of color, and drizzle a bit of honey over the top just before serving for an enticing finish.
